AMPol-Q: Adaptive Middleware Policy to Support QoS
نویسندگان
چکیده
There are many problems hindering the design and development of Service-Oriented Architectures (SOAs), which can dynamically discover and compose multiple services so that the quality of the composite service is measured by its End-to-End (E2E) quality, rather than that of individual services in isolation. The diversity and complexity of QoS constraints further limit the widescale adoption of QoS-aware SOA. We propose extensions to current OWL-S service description mechanisms to describe QoS information of all the candidate services. Our middleware based solution, AMPol-Q, enables clients to discover, select, compose, and monitor services that fulfil E2E QoS constraints. Our implementation and case studies demonstrate how AMPol-Q can accomplish these goals for web services that implement messaging.
منابع مشابه
Flexible and Extensible Qos-management for Adaptive Middleware
The task of middleware is to mask out problems of heterogeneity and distribution for application developers. With the emergence of new application domains, like multimedia and real-time applications, flexible support of QoS and real-time requirements becomes a major challenge. Reconfigurable bindings and policy driven binding protocols are the major means in the MULTE framework to support these...
متن کاملSupporting Large-scale Continuous Stream Datacenters via Pub/Sub Middleware and Adaptive Transport Protocols
Large-scale datacenters that handle continuous data streams require scalable and flexible communication infrastructure. The scalability of publish/subscribe (pub/sub) middleware coupled with fine-grained quality-of-service (QoS) support and adaptive transport protocols constitutes a promising area of research to address the challenges of these types of large-scale datacenters. This paper descri...
متن کاملEnhancing the Adaptivity of Distributed Real-time and Embedded Systems via Standard QoS-enabled Dynamic Scheduling Middleware
To support the dynamically changing QoS needs of open distributed real-time embedded (DRE) systems, it is essential to propagate QoS parameters and to enforce task QoS requirements adaptably across multiple endsystems dynamically in a way that is simultaneously efficient, flexible, and timely. This paper makes three contributions to research on QoS-enabled middleware that supports these types o...
متن کاملTotal quality of service provisioning in middleware and applications
Commercial off-the-shelf (COTS) distribution middleware is gaining acceptance in the distributed real-time and embedded (DRE) community. Existing COTS specifications, however, do not effectively separate quality of service (QoS) policy configurations and adaptations from application functionality. DRE application developers therefore often intersperse code that provisions resources for QoS guar...
متن کاملProgramming QOS in Mobile Multimedia Networks
This paper presents an open programmable middleware platform for mobile multimedia networking called mobiware. Built on advanced distributed object technology including active objects, proxies and agents, mobiware, dynamically exploits the intrinsic scalable properties of multimedia content by responding to time-varying wireless and mobile QOS conditions. At the core of mobiware lies a novel ad...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2006